About Valley Vista Elementary
Valley Vista Elementary is a public elementary school in Petaluma, CA, part of Petaluma City Elementary. Valley Vista Elementary serves approximately 192 students, and covers grades Kindergarten-6th, and has a 24:1 student-teacher ratio. Valley Vista Elementary has a current MySchoolScout rating of 3.1 out of 10 and ranks #9,253 of 9,539 schools in CA.
Structured state assessment records for Valley Vista Elementary show 39%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024) and 44%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024).

What Parents Should Know
At 192 students, Valley Vista Elementary is on the smaller side. That usually buys more individual attention and teachers who know every kid by name, with the trade-off of fewer electives and extracurriculars than a larger school can staff. Ask what activities it actually offers.
Valley Vista Elementary runs 24:1 students to teachers, above the national average. That often means bigger classes. Ask how the school supports kids who need extra help, and whether there are teaching assistants or small-group time.
37% of students at Valley Vista Elementary were chronically absent in the 2022-23 school year, above the national average. Chronic absenteeism means missing 15 or more school days, and at high rates it drags on classroom pacing for everyone. Ask what the school does to help families get kids to class consistently.
